Polskie forum 3dfx
Retro Computers >> Hardware PC >> SS7 dużo sprzętu konflikt IRQ
http://3dfx.pl/cgi-bin/yabb2/YaBB.pl?num=1632241566

Message started by Jenot on 21. Sep 2021 at 18:26

Title: SS7 dużo sprzętu konflikt IRQ
Post by Jenot on 21. Sep 2021 at 18:26
Jest sobie płyta GA-5AX, w slotach siedzi sobie FX 5700U (bo potrzebne DVI), 3Com 3c509 w PCI, GUS MAX i AWE CT2760.
GUS ustawiony na 220h, IRQ7, DMA1, DMA 16bit - 1,
AWE: 240H, IRQ5, DMA3, DMA 16bit - 5

I teraz tak - bios PnP ustawia sieciówkę z automatu na IRQ5, nie wiedząc że siedzi tam AWE. W DOSie nie ma to znaczenia, bo nawet jak załaduję packet driver to najwyżej mi AWE nie zagra - przeżyję.
Schody robią się pod OS/2, który Plug'n'Play nieby obsługuje, ale nie do końca. Boot zawisa na sterowniku AWE (konflikt, bo wcześniej załadował się sterownik 3Com), bez sterownika AWE wszystko działa bez zarzutu.

Jak to obejść? Wydaje mi się, że próbowałem już prawie wszystkiego - rezerwowałem IRQ5 dla ISA - niby fajnie, 3Com wziął sobie IRQ3 (Serial mam wyłączony), ale przestał działać AWE, nawet w DOSie. Okazuje się, że ten AWE jest PnP, ale nie zgłasza, że rezerwuje zasoby co powoduje błędy, zresztą specjalnie dla tego modelu dla sterownika OS/2 trzeba zapodać przełącznik /P (broken PnP). Próbowałem kartę wkłądać do innych slotów PCI - uparcie "kradnie" IRQ5, próbowałem ją wymienić na Realteka RTL8139C (i 8139D) - ten sam efekt. Próbowałem zmienić IRQ we wszystkich sieciówkach ich narzędziami konfiguracyjnymi - IRQ jest niekonfigurowalne - programy każą mi się walić, bo karty są PnP. W biosie wybierałem PnP OS yes i no, resources na auto i manual - bez zmian. Nie ma opcji przypisania INT do slotów PCI.

Mogę coś jeszcze zrobić, bo pomysły mi się skończyły?

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by 314TeR on 21. Sep 2021 at 20:34

Jenot wrote on 21. Sep 2021 at 18:26:
Mogę coś jeszcze zrobić, bo pomysły mi się skończyły?
                   

Zmień płytę... ;)  żart...

Piszesz o 3C905? bo 509 to ISA. 905 występują też w paru jeśli nie parunastu rewizjach. Z mojego doświadczenia, a przewaliłem akurat 905 dosłownie setki, to są to jedne z najmniej problematycznych kart. #IRQ przypisuje początkowo BIOS płyty, z reguły konkretny slot PCI = konkretne IRQ. Jak chciałem uzyskać konkretne IRQ, to zaczynałem od wywalenia wszystkie z kompa oprócz VGA, potem reset ESCD* (o ile w BIOSie jest), a następnie dodaję po jednej karcie sprawdzając jaki IRQ jest jej przydzielany. Jak nie pasuje, to zmiana slotu PCI i reset ESCD.

*Czasami są w BIOSie śmieci w ESCD do tego stopnia że płyta pogtrafi nie wstać, pomaga wtedy wydłubać bios i przeflashować go dziewiczą wersją z strony producenta.

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Jenot on 21. Sep 2021 at 20:40
No właśnie na tej płycie tak to nie działa. Każdy slot PCI - IRQ5. Udało mi się przekonać bios do zmiany IRQ dopiero przez wyłączenie USB, z którego i tak w zasadzie nie korzystam. Teraz jeszcze pozostaje ożywienie AWE pod OS/2 bo uparł się, że będzie korzystał z IO 220h i DMA1, gdzie akurat "siedzi" GUS. Zaraz mnie coś trafi...

Co do sieciówki to tak, 3c905, mam kilka, z każdą to samo, to nie problem kart, tylko płyty głównej. Jakimś rozwiązaniem byłaby karta na ISA, ale mam same padła...

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by 314TeR on 21. Sep 2021 at 21:05
Jaką dokładnie masz 5AX i jakie 905? Możesz wrzucić fotki?

Mam 5AX po jednej w rewizji 4.x i 5.x, może udało by mi się zasymulować u siebie ten problem. 905 za to masę, intele też. W razie czego mogę Ci jakaś sprezentować.

BTW - tak czy siak jak masz programator przeflashuj kość BIOS lub wręcz możesz spróbować zamienić ją na inną.

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Jenot on 21. Sep 2021 at 21:43
Rev. 3 o ile pamiętam. Fotki zrobię jutro. Pod DOSem nie ma już żadnego problemu - zero konfliktów (Po wyłączeniu USB 3com dostał IRQ 10). Sterownik pod OS/2 dalej się burzy, nawet po wyjęciu GUSa. BIOS na gigusiu jest najnowszy (z obsługą "plusów"). Problem leży głębiej - chyba sterownik AWE jest zrypany - albo wywala mi rejestry na ekran, albo sypie komunikatem, że nie może zresetować AWE do ustawień, które mam zapisane jako parametry sterownika (a próbowałem różnych).
Jutro na drugim dysku spróbuję zainstalować Warpa na nowo, chociaż to droga przez mękę - system, Fixpaki systemu, Fixpaki TCP/IP, fixpaki MMOS2 i dopiero można zabrać się za konfigurację. Wolę pod OS/2 AWE, bo działa lepiej niż GUS - zero problemów w sesjach DOS czy WinOS/2, działa MIDI z bankami SBK, jest masa softu. GUS ma tylko sterownik dla programów OS/2, w sesjach DOS/Windows jest głucha cisza.

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by forteller on 21. Sep 2021 at 22:54
Ja nie rozumiem dlaczego GUS konfigurujesz na adresie 220 i DMA 1. Wiele gier pod tymi ustawieniami (i irq 5) spodziewa się sound blastera, a nie spotkałem się żeby z gusem były problemy jeśli jest ustawiony na adres 240, irq 7, DMA 3. Jest jakiś powód, dla którego masz to na odwrót?

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Jenot on 22. Sep 2021 at 11:39
Hmm, jak jest poprawnie skonfigurowana zmienna BLASTER, to większość gier nie posiadających konfiguratorów sobie z tym radzi bez problemu.

Takie ustawienie GUSa jest dla mnie najwygodniejsze jak łączę go z innymi kartami  (EWS64, PAS16, Soundscape, SB PCI). Mam gotowe konfigi, nie chce mi się już tego zmieniać.

Ale, zdaje się znalazłem powód dla którego nie działa AWE. Wcześniej miałem SB32 PnP (nie pamiętam oznaczenia) i działał pod OS/2 bez problemu. Ten mój CT2760 to takie ni to PnP, ni to nonPnp - IO ustawia się zworką, resztę robi sterownik (DMA, IRQ), i pod OS2 to nie działa, ani ze sterownikiem od PnP, ani od zwykłego AWE. Albo nie może ustawić IO (jak wybiorę sterownik PnP), albo IRQ (jak wybiorę nonPnP), mam komunikat "can't reset AWE32 device" i wisi, albo od razu wywala rejestry.

Z GUSem czy PAS16 problemów nie ma. Nowszych sterowników nie ma. Muszę się pogodzić z tym, że mój AWE jednak nie zadziała z Warpem.

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by forteller on 22. Sep 2021 at 12:38
Będę sprzedawał CT3990 który jest pełnym PnP jak coś, aczkolwiek nie ma oryginalnego OPL3.

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by 314TeR on 22. Sep 2021 at 15:18
No te starsze karty trzeba ustawiać konfiguratorem, tylko czy to się nie robiło aby raz i nie pamiętał ustawień?

Osobiście mam od nowości AWE32 CT3980 - ostatnie AWE32 z OPL3 (no prawie) i jak czytam o problemach z kartami P&P to ja chyba byłem dziwny, bo nie miałem z nią jazd jakie przypisujecie kartom P&P, ale fakt, używana była od ~P75 na płycie SOYO 5TF, która ten P&P posiadała.

@forteller - wiesz, że CT3990 da się przerobić z CQM na OPL3 - ba nawet laminat ma miejsce na oryginalny chip Yamahy. Creative po prostu poskąpił $$$ i dlatego nie ma na większości kart układów OPL3, ale były egzemplarze, które miały. W tym wątku znajdziesz informacje potrzebne do przeróbki:   (You need to Login or Register.

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by forteller on 22. Sep 2021 at 15:27
Jakoś nie mam SB16 którego mógłbym poświęcić :P Z resztą, samo AWE32 nie jest dla mnie na tyle wartościowe, żeby robić transplantację z innej karty - gdybym miał SB16 z prawdziwym OPL3, to po prostu jej bym użył zamiast AWE32. Jakoś nie rajcuje mnie zmienianie soundfontów po prostu :)

Niemniej, tematu nie znałem i jest bardzo ciekawy!

EDIT:
Hmm... części (a konkretniej - kostki Yamaha) można zamówić. Może zastanowię się nad tym tematem w takim razie! Dzięki!

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by 314TeR on 22. Sep 2021 at 15:37

forteller wrote on 22. Sep 2021 at 15:27:
Hmm... części (a konkretniej - kostki Yamaha) można zamówić. Może zastanowię się nad tym tematem w takim razie! Dzięki!
                   

Bardzo proszę - i ewentualną pomocą jakbyś potrzebował przy montażu. BTW mi osobiście wydaje się, że CT3990 z OPL3 jest o wiele ciekawszym eksponatem niż np CT3980 które go miały standardowo, a przy dozie wiedzy i umiejętności modyfikację można zrobić tak, że nikt niczego nie pozna, że było dokładane... no chyba, że ktoś mi wytknie, że zrobiłem za dobrą cyną bo się bardziej świeci niż reszta połączeń.  ;) :D

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by forteller on 22. Sep 2021 at 15:54
Na razie trzeba zamówić części póki są dostępne. Trafi pewnie do pudła rzeczy "na kiedyś" razem z poprawieniem umiejętności w lutowaniu :) Ale dzięki Tobie podejmuję decyzję o wstrzymaniu sprzedaży mojego CT3990 :) Ze wszystkich moich kart Creative na ISA szumi najmniej - mniej nawet niż AWE64 Gold i Value.

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Jenot on 23. Sep 2021 at 16:54
Dla mnie AWE to karta dobra tylko w jednym - w emulacji SB16. Poza tym to same problemy. Póki co optymalny zestaw to GUS (demoscena, gry które go obsługują) i EWS64 (midi, emulacja SBPro i WSS do gier). AWE na razie poleciał - nie mam siły z nim walczyć. Ciekawostka - EWS64 to karta w zasadzie full PnP i działa bez problemu, ale w programie konfiguracyjnym da się z niej zrobić nonPnP ustawiając zasoby z palca, i też działa. Zero problemów, czyli da się, a Creative to niestety była i jest padlina. Że też taki Aureal czy Ensoniq musiały upaść...

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by 314TeR on 23. Sep 2021 at 19:58

Jenot wrote on 23. Sep 2021 at 16:54:
Dla mnie AWE to karta dobra tylko w jednym - w emulacji SB16

Bo to jest SB16 + WaveBlaster na jednej płytce. :P

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by sajmon on 23. Sep 2021 at 23:33
chyba nie do końca , awe32 miał próbki 512kb , wave blaster w wersji 1 miał 4mb a a wersji 2 2mb próbek

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by 314TeR on 24. Sep 2021 at 00:01

sajmon wrote on 23. Sep 2021 at 23:33:
chyba nie do końca , awe32 miał próbki 512kb , wave blaster w wersji 1 miał 4mb a a wersji 2 2mb próbek


Być może - tego nie wiem, natomiast wciąż SB16 jest mniej więcej taki sam na AWE32 co na SB16. Więc technicznie rzecz biorąc to AWE32 jest SB16 + Wave.

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Neo on 24. Sep 2021 at 10:06
Nie prawda. AWE wszystkie mają ROM 1MB. I brzmią inaczej niż WaveBlastery, posłuchajcie na soundcloudzie Batyry. Ale część SB16 owszem taka sama, tyle że mniej szumi ;)

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by sajmon on 30. Sep 2021 at 00:38
o tak pomyliłem z dram

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by GL1zdA on 18. Oct 2021 at 22:23

Neo wrote on 24. Sep 2021 at 10:06:
Nie prawda. AWE wszystkie mają ROM 1MB. I brzmią inaczej niż WaveBlastery, posłuchajcie na soundcloudzie Batyry. Ale część SB16 owszem taka sama, tyle że mniej szumi ;)

Bo WaveBlastery były dwa. Pierwszy CT1900 i drugi CT1910. Tylko ten drugi ma dźwięk zbliżony do AWE32, ma większy ROM (2 MB vs 1 MB na AWE32).

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Callahan on 31. Oct 2021 at 20:21
@Jenot
Wyłącz w pi…du port LPT w biosie

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Jenot on 31. Oct 2021 at 20:48

Callahan wrote on 31. Oct 2021 at 20:21:
@Jenot
Wyłącz w pi…du port LPT w biosie


To jest pierwsza rzecz jaką robię po wejściu do biosa na nowym sprzęcie. Podobnie z COM1 i COM2 (no chyba, że nie ma PS/2). Sprawa rozwiązana - nie wiedzieć czemu karta 3com na PCI wbijała się na IRQ7 - zawsze, i nic nie pomagało. Ale temat już ogarnięty i spokojnie mogę posłuchać Second Reality :)

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Callahan on 01. Nov 2021 at 12:00
A nie pozamieniałeś kart w portach, że ten cud jasnogórski się zdarzył ?  ;D

Title: Re: SS7 dużo sprzętu konflikt IRQ
Post by Jenot on 01. Nov 2021 at 13:54
Karta sieciowa, obojętnie w którym slocie PCI, dostawała IRQ7, nawet jak resetowałem ESCD, jedyne co pomagało to włączenie LPT, wtedy grzecznie wskakiwała na IRQ3. Narzędzie od 3com do tej karty nie ustawia przerwania - nie ma takiej opcji. Ot, uroki wczesnego PnP.

Polskie forum 3dfx » Powered by YaBB 2.6.1!
YaBB Forum Software © 2000-2024. All Rights Reserved.